> Linux 查看端口占用情况可以使用 lsof 和 netstat 命令。 一、lsof命令 lsof(list open files)是一个列出当前系统打开文件的工具。 lsof 查看端口占用语法格式: lsof -i:端口号 实例: 查看服务器 8000 端口的占用情况: # lsof -i:8000 COMMAND PID USER FD TYPE DEVICE SIZE/OFF NODE NAME nodejs 26993 ...
1、查看端口是否被占用 1 2 3 4 [guosong@alice48 main]$ netstat -nlp|grep 6184 (Not all processes could be identified, non-owned process info will not be shown, you would have to be root to see it all.) tcp 0 0 0.0.0.0:6184 0.0.0.0:* LISTEN 32429/python26 1 2 3 4 5 6 7 ...
Linux查看端口占用进程 netstat -anlp|grep 8081 tcp /java 此处3195为进程ID Windows 查看端口占用进程并关闭
首先,使用netstat命令查看指定端口是否被占用,然后使用docker ps命令查找该占用端口的容器。 以下是一个示例脚本,用于查找端口号为8080的Docker服务: #!/bin/bash# 查找端口号为8080的服务port=8080result=$(netstat-tuln|grep$port)# 如果端口被占用if[-n"$result"];thenecho"端口$port被占用!"container_id=$(...
话不多说,本文介绍Linux常规操作:查看端口占用进程,根据PID kill掉相关进程。另外补充:根据程序名查看进程PID。 首先,两条命令,lsof命令和netstat命令。 方式一:lsof命令 1、查看占用端口进程的PID: lsof -i:{端口号} 2、根据PID kill掉相关进程: kill -9 {PID} ...
Linux下服务一般是通过shell脚本来启动程序或者服务,在shell脚本启动时,可以使用命令来查询,本服务或程序端口是否被其他程序占用,可以使用netstat命令。netstat 比如我们查询80端口是否被占用,命令如下:netstat-anp|grep80 从上面可以看出80端口已经被nginx监听。netstat具体的参数如下,【-a】显示所有的...
linux kill进程没有立刻停止 2019-12-12 16:45 − 前些天在执行restart脚本的时候遇到了一个奇怪的问题:1、第一次执行进程不见了,启动失败2、第二次重启进程成功,但是在kill的时候提示进程不存在需要重启两次进程才能成功 查看日志文件:第一次重启失败是因为端口被占用,那么意味着进程没有被kill掉。第二次...
Linux查看Java进程PID、端口号和内存占用脚本Linux查看Java进程PID、端口号和内存占用脚本 背景 查询PID 查询占用端口查询内存占用百分比 脚本 使用 背景 正常情况下,一个jps...-ml就可以查看机器上有多少Java进程以及它们的PID,如果还要看端口号,甚至内存占用,就还要配合netstat以及ps等查询,如果直接使用一个命令就能查...
1. 查看Linux启动的服务 chkconfig --list 查询出所有当前运行的服务 chkconfig --list atd 查询atd服务的当前状态 2.停止所有服务并且在下次系统启动时不再启动,如下所示: chkconfig --levels 12345 NetworkManager off 如果想查看当前处于运行状态的服务,用如下语句过滤即可 ...
id_seq@linux:/www/server/mysql/bin$ sudo ss-tuln|grep:3306tcp600:::33060:::*LISTENtcp600:::3306:::*LISTEN 显示所有使用80端口的进程。它会列出包括进程名称、进程ID(PID)以及使用80端口的详细信息。 代码语言:javascript 复制 id_seq@linux:/www/server/mysql/bin$ sudo lsof-i:3306COMMANDPIDUSERFD...